1. Summary of Electric Running Machines
Electric running machines are workout devices developed to simulate running or walking while enabling users to control speed and slope. They come equipped with a motor that powers the belt, enabling a smooth and consistent surface for walking or running.
Kinds Of Electric Running Machines:
| Type | Description | Best For |
|---|---|---|
| Standard Treadmill | Standard model for walking and running | Novices to intermediates |
| Folding Treadmill | Space-saving design for home usage | Limited space environments |
| Commercial Treadmill | Long lasting and high-performance for gyms | Physical fitness centers |
| Smart Treadmill | Connected to apps and devices for tracking | Tech-savvy users |
2. Secret Benefits of Using Electric Running Machines
Electric running machines use a number of advantages over standard outside running. Here are a few of the key advantages:
Weather Independence: Treadmills enable for exercises regardless of external weather-- be it rain, snow, or extreme temperatures.
Control Over Intensity: Users can adjust speed and slope, making it easier to tailor workouts to their fitness level and goals.
Security: Running on a treadmill minimizes the danger of injury that might come from irregular outdoor surface, traffic, or other environmental dangers.
Convenience: Having a treadmill in the house can conserve time and boost consistency in workout routines.
Tracking Progress: Most electric running machines come with digital displays that track time, range, calories burned, and heart rate.
3. Important Features to Consider
When choosing an electric running machine, there are numerous features to think about. The most important consist of:
| Feature | Description | Importance |
|---|---|---|
| Motor Power | Measured in horse power (HP), effects speed and sturdiness | Greater HP is usually much better |
| Running Surface Size | The length and width of the belt | Impacts comfort while running |
| Speed Range | Maximum speed settings readily available | Guarantees versatility |
| Incline Capability | Ability to change slope levels | Improves workout intensity |
| Cushioning System | Innovation created to decrease influence on joints | Improves comfort and security |
| Display Console | Interface for tracking data and engaging with programs | Vital for user experience |
| Connectivity | Bluetooth and app compatibility | Helps in tracking development |

5. Maintenance Tips
Correct maintenance of electric running machines is important to guarantee their durability and efficiency. Here are some pointers:
Regular Cleaning: Dust and sweat can accumulate on the machine; wipe it down after every usage.
Lubrication: Treadmill belts need to be lubed occasionally to guarantee smooth operation. Follow the manufacturer's directions for the kind of lubricant to utilize.
Examine the Belt Alignment: Periodically inspect to make sure the running belt is centered. Misalignment can cause wear and tear.
Check the Motor and Electronics: Regularly examine and listen for any unusual noises from the motor or electronic devices. Address issues right away to prevent additional damage.
Use a Surge Protector: Protect your treadmill from electrical surges which can harm its parts.
6. FAQ
Q1: How typically should I use my treadmill?A: It mostly depends upon your physical fitness goals. For general health, intending for a minimum of 150 minutes of moderate aerobic activity weekly is advised.
Q2: Can treadmills truly assist with weight reduction?A: Yes, when integrated with a balanced diet, constant use of a treadmill can contribute substantially to weight reduction and total fitness.
Q3: Are electric running machines noisy?A: Noise levels vary by design. Most contemporary treadmills are designed to operate silently; nevertheless, it's necessary to read evaluations to find a design that fulfills your noise preferences.
Q4: Is it safe to use a treadmill every day?A: Using a treadmill daily is normally safe for a lot of people. However, it's vital to listen to your body and integrate day of rest as needed.
Q5: What is the typical lifespan of a treadmill?A: With proper maintenance, an electric running machine can last anywhere from 7 to 12 years, depending on the design and use frequency.
